The NAOI Segment Allocation
Calculator
Now use the following calculator to
test multiple portfolio designs on your own. Your inputs are:
- Segment
Target Return. At this point you will need to guess at
this percentage. The NAOI believes that the Target Return numbers
presented in the above table are feasible. You will only be able
to project a Target Return of your own for a Segment
after you have graduated from the corresponding NAOI Course. For now simply
vary the numbers and view the results on the Total Portfolio Return.
You may not now believe that such high returns are possible. The
NAOI is confident that as you graduate from each course your view
will change.
- Segment Allocation. This is the amount of your total investing
funds that you will allocate to each Segment. You may not want to
include all Segments in your portfolio. You can put a zero
allocation on any you wish to exclude. The Allocation variable
allows you to adjust the Risk/Return profile of your Portfolio.
Greater allocations to Core Funds will reduce risk and return.
Greater allocations to Individual Stocks will increase risk and
return.
